Remember that old song...One of these things is not like the other - One of these things does not belong? Well, I thought maybe it might make an interesting game so let's give it a try!

List four items. One of them must not belong to the group. After guessing the answer, please explain why the item does not belong!

Example:
Salamander - Turtle - Frog - Toad
Answer:
Turtle - A Turtle is not an amphibian
-or-
Example:
Greg - Peter - Wally - Bobby
Answer:
Wally - The other three were sons on the Brady Bunch

You all get the idea? The regular rules apply :rules: Wait for a confirmation before posting your own list and all that jazz. Let's get this show on the road then!
